BREAKING: Gunmen Attack Convoy Of Emir Of Kaura Namoda

meridianspyBy meridianspyDecember 18, 2020Updated:December 18, 2020No Comments1 Min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email
Share
    

Share!

  • Share
  • Tweet

Some unknown gunmen have reportedly attacked the convoy of Sanusi Muhammad, Emir of Kaura Namoda in Zamfara state, killing eight people on his entourage.

Channels TV reports the attack occurred on Thursday night while the Emir was on his way back from Abuja.

Three of his police escort were said to be shot dead as well as five other people.
